#429324 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#429324 is composed of 25.9% red, 57.6%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.5%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 103.8 degrees, a saturation of 60.7% and a lightness of 35.9%. #429324 color hex could be obtained by blending #84ff48 with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#429324 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#429324 has RGB values of R:66, G:147,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 4363044.

Shades and Tints of #429324
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020501 is the darkest color, while #f7fcf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#429324
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#596255 is the less saturated color, while #32b601 is the most saturated one.
